Output 62eba49c30390407c3f8154e8257150c0ecd955cbbf8d08c3d415df4a59601f6:1

value
100212835
script pubkey
OP_0 OP_PUSHBYTES_20 f6befd5aa4cc7ae52b80dd1e9e44a30992910a8b
address
bc1q76l06k4ye3aw22uqm50fu39rpxffzz5tzed9a3
transaction
62eba49c30390407c3f8154e8257150c0ecd955cbbf8d08c3d415df4a59601f6
spent
true